1. A 67 y.o man is brought to the ED because of a 3 day history of fever and headache. Five years ago, he underwent placement of a mechanical aortic valve for treatment of sequelae of rheumatic fever. He appears ill. His temperature is 40, 110/65mmHg pulse is 110 and res are 22. Agrade 3/6 systolic ejection murmur is heard. Neurologic examination shows mild left hemiparesis. Babinski’s sign is present on the left. There is no nuchal rigidity. This pt is a greatest risk for which of the following complication.

a) brain abscess
b) carotid artery occlusion
c) encephalitis
d) hydrocephalus
e) venous sinus thrombosis

2. A37 y.o. woman comes to the physician because of an itchy rash over ther trunk for 2wks. She has not had fever, chills, shortness of breath, chest pain, or gastrointestinal symptoms. She has a history of recurrent UTI and has been taking TMPSMZ prophylaxis for the past year. She is in mild distress. Her temperature is 37.5, blood pressure is 9/62mmHg, pulse is 78, resp 14min. examination shows a maculopapular erythematous rash over the trunk. Lab studies show:
Leukocyte count 10,500/mm3
Seg neutrophils 72%
Bands 1%
Eosinophils 15%
Lymphocytes 4%
Monocytes 8%
Serum
BUN 12 mg/dL
Creatinine 0.9 mg/dL
Urine : normal
Which of the following is most likely cause of these findings?
a) eczema
b) med adverse effect
c) Staphylococcal skin infection
d) Streptococcal Skin infection
e) UTI
